Environment Ministry: Hold mobile phone 2 cm from ear

MK Rachel Adatto (Kadima): Preventative measures should be taken, including a ban on bringing mobile phones to schools.

"Holding a mobile phone 2 centimeters from the ear lowers the level of radiation to zero," Ministry of Environmental Protection radiation division head Dr. Gelberg told the Knesset Labor, Welfare and Health Committee today. "We are updated by the World Health Organization (WHO) about its position on radiation and the best way to reduce radiation is with absorbent stickers, which distance the phone from the ear."

The Labor, Welfare and Health Committee is discussing mobile phone radiation following several reports, including by the WHO, warning about a possible link between extensive use of mobile phones and increased risk of cancer.

Prof. Sigal Sadetzky, head of the Gertner Institute for Epidemiology and Health Policy Research at the Sheba Medical Center (Tel Hashomer) told the committee that the Israeli government has never financed a study on radiation emissions from mobile phones. The Gertner Institute is investigating the issue. "It is completely absurd that the government does not allocate resources and budgets to research on the risk of radiation from mobile phones. Every study that I have conducted was financed by outside parties."

MK Rachel Adatto (Kadima), a doctor, said that given the uncertainty about the effects of radiation from mobile phones, preventative measures should be taken, including a ban on bringing mobile phones to schools. Her proposal was partly based on a study presented to the committee, which found that half of Israeli children and teenagers have mobile phones.

Sadetzky rejected the suggestion, saying, "Mobile phones should not be banned from educational institutions because the public won't stand for it. However, positive messages should be given on the issue, and pupils trained in the proper use of mobile phones."

The Knesset Research and Information Center presented figures to the committee on the extensive mobile phone use in Israel compared with other countries. Israel has 126 mobile phone subscribers per 100 people. There are 5.3 billion mobile phone subscribers worldwide, a seven-fold increase in ten years.
